Solution for 7(v+4)=70 equation:



7(v+4)=70
We move all terms to the left:
7(v+4)-(70)=0
We multiply parentheses
7v+28-70=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7v-42=0
We move all terms containing v to the left, all other terms to the right
7v=42
v=42/7
v=6
